 1) A+B+C can do a work in 12 days. B+ C can do work in 18 days. A+ B can do work un 15 days. If b do the work alone, then how many days needed

We are given:

  • A + B + C can do the work in 12 days

  • B + C can do the work in 18 days

  • A + B can do the work in 15 days

We are to find how many days B alone will take to complete the work.

Step 1: Convert to Work Rates

Let the total work be LCM of 12, 18, 15 = 180 units (assume total work is 180 units for easier calculation).

Now compute each group’s work per day:

  • (A + B + C)’s rate = 180 / 12 = 15 units/day

  • (B + C)’s rate = 180 / 18 = 10 units/day

  • (A + B)’s rate = 180 / 15 = 12 units/day


Step 2: Subtract to find individual rates

From above:

  • A + B + C = 15

  • B + C = 10
    So, A = 15 − 10 = 5 units/day

Also:

  • A + B = 12
    We already know A = 5, so:

  • B = 12 − 5 = 7 units/day


Step 3: Find Days for B to Finish Work Alone

If B works at 7 units/day, and total work is 180 units:
